Does Outdoor Paint Have Primer In It. Primer is an essential foundation for outdoor paint applications, providing a cohesive surface for improved adhesion, ensuring paint durability, and protecting against weathering and flaking. A primer coat for exterior paint is important for surface adhesion. It helps create a strong bond between the old and new coats of. So yes, the short answer is that primer is almost always a part of the exterior house painting process, but you don’t always need a “full prime.” sometimes all you need is a “spot prime,” covering just specific areas.
